Infant mortality rate in India in 2012 was ______ .
40
47
57
60
- Infant Mortality Rate (IMR) refers to the number of infant deaths (under 1 year) per 1,000 live births.
- In 2012, India's IMR was an important statistic illustrating its public health status.
- Option 1: 40 - This was not the IMR for India in 2012.
- Option 2: 47 - This accurately reflects India's 2012 IMR.
- Option 3: 57 - This is higher than the actual figure.
- Option 4: 60 - This figure overstates the IMR for the year 2012.
